What Carbohydrates Are And How They Work

Carbohydrates are molecules made of carbon, hydrogen, and oxygen. In food, they appear as sugars, starches, and fiber. During digestion, enzymes break most carbohydrates down into glucose. That glucose then moves into the bloodstream and provides energy to cells across the body.

The brain, nervous system, and red blood cells rely heavily on glucose as their preferred fuel. When blood glucose stays low for long stretches, these cells struggle, which is one reason sudden, strict carbohydrate cuts can feel so draining for many people.

Not every carbohydrate acts the same way after you eat. The type, the amount of fiber, and whether the food is processed or whole all change how quickly glucose appears in your blood and how steady your energy feels over the next few hours.

Carbohydrate Type Common Foods Main Role In The Body
Simple sugars Table sugar, honey, fruit juice, sweets Provide quick energy, raise blood glucose fast
Natural sugars in whole foods Whole fruit, milk, yogurt Give energy along with vitamins, minerals, and fluid
Starches Bread, rice, pasta, potatoes, oats Supply steady fuel as they break down into glucose
Dietary fiber Vegetables, whole grains, beans, lentils Supports digestion, gut health, and blood sugar control
Resistant starch Cooled potatoes, green bananas, some whole grains Feeds gut bacteria and may help with insulin response
Added sugars Sodas, candies, sweetened cereals, pastries Add energy with few nutrients, easy to overconsume
Refined grains White bread, many crackers, regular pasta Provide starch with much of the fiber and micronutrients removed

Alongside blood glucose control, carbohydrates influence cholesterol balance, gut bacteria, and how full you feel after a meal. Fiber from whole grains, fruit, vegetables, and legumes slows digestion and helps you feel satisfied on fewer calories.

Carbohydrates Required For Body And Brain Energy

Energy production sits at the center of why carbohydrate intake for body health deserves attention. Each gram of carbohydrate provides about four calories of energy. Glucose from those carbohydrates fuels daily movement, organ function, and every step your cells take to stay alive.

The brain uses a large share of this glucose each day. Red blood cells also rely almost fully on glucose. When carbohydrate intake drops very low, the body pulls from stored glycogen in the liver and muscles, then starts breaking down fat and some protein to cover the gap.

Nutrition standards for adults set a daily minimum of about 130 grams of carbohydrate. That amount covers basic brain needs, though many people feel and perform better when they’re eating more carbohydrate, especially when they’re active.

How Many Carbohydrates Per Day Do Most People Need

Public health guidance describes a range rather than one fixed target. Many guidelines suggest that around 45 to 65 percent of total daily calories can come from carbohydrate sources. At 2,000 calories per day, this works out to roughly 225 to 325 grams of carbohydrate.

Inside this band, the right point for you depends on body size, age, activity level, and health history. Someone who trains for long-distance running twice a day stands at a different spot on the range than someone with a desk job who takes gentle walks.

Trusted nutrition sites that explain these ranges also stress that most of this carbohydrate share should come from whole grains, vegetables, fruit, and pulses, not from sugary drinks or pastries. Some people follow lower carbohydrate plans for weight management or blood sugar control. These approaches can work for some, yet the body still needs enough carbohydrate so you don’t face constant fatigue, muscle loss, and ketosis. Many experts point to at least 50 to 100 grams per day as a threshold to limit strong ketone buildup for most adults, though needs differ.

Choosing Better Sources Of Carbohydrates

Quantity answers only part of the question. Quality shapes how you feel after eating and how your risk for long term conditions changes. Whole carbohydrate foods carry fiber, water, and a mix of vitamins and minerals. Refined and heavily sweetened choices often crowd these out.

Nutrition guidance from government and medical groups encourages people to favor whole grains, fruit, vegetables, and legumes as primary carbohydrate sources. These foods tend to digest more slowly, give steadier energy, and support a healthy gut environment.

Whole Versus Refined Carbohydrate Sources

Whole grains such as brown rice, oats, and whole wheat bread still contain the bran and germ parts of the grain, where most of the fiber and micronutrients sit. Refined grains like white bread or regular pasta keep mainly the starch portion. That difference shows up in blood sugar curves and in how full you feel after a meal.

Sweet drinks and desserts bring in large amounts of added sugar without much fiber or protein. They can fit into an eating pattern, yet frequent, large servings often push calorie intake beyond what your body needs.

Daily Calories Carb Range (Grams/Day) Typical Example
1,600 180–260 Smaller adult with light movement
2,000 225–325 Average adult intake pattern
2,400 270–390 Taller adult or active lifestyle
2,800 315–455 Person with heavy physical work or training
3,200 360–520 Endurance athlete or very active job

These ranges come from applying the 45 to 65 percent guideline and dividing by four calories per gram. Personal targets sit inside those bands and may shift with time as weight, fitness, or health conditions change.

Adjusting Carbohydrate Needs For Different Lifestyles

Carbohydrate needs shift with life stage, body size, and how active you are. Children need enough carbohydrate to cover growth and school activities. Adults often match intake to work demands and exercise. Older adults still need carbohydrate for brain and muscle function, though total calorie needs may fall.

People who train hard on most days often do better with more carbohydrate, especially around workouts, because muscles don’t refill glycogen stores on their own. Extra carbohydrate before and after training helps keep performance from fading across the week.

Certain medical conditions change the picture. People with diabetes or kidney disease, or those using specific medications, often follow detailed plans built by their health care team. In those settings, blood sugar and other lab results guide how much and what type of carbohydrate fits best.

Special Situations That Raise Carbohydrate Requirements

Pregnancy and breastfeeding raise energy needs in general, so carbohydrate requirements usually rise too. Endurance training blocks, such as marathon preparation, also call for higher carbohydrate intake across the day and especially before and after long sessions.

Signs Your Carbohydrate Intake May Be Off

The body sends signals when carbohydrate intake does not match needs for long periods. Low intake can lead to fatigue, trouble focusing, irritability, or dizziness, especially later in the day or during activity. Long running low intake may trigger weight loss, muscle loss, and constant feelings of cold.

Very low intake also encourages higher ketone production. Some people follow structured ketogenic plans under supervision, yet strong ketone buildup outside that context can lead to nausea, dehydration, and strain on organs.

High intake brings its own patterns. Frequent spikes in blood sugar and a steady surplus of calories can make weight creep up over time. Teeth may suffer when sugary drinks and sticky sweets sit on them day after day.

Pay attention to how you feel between meals, during exercise, and through the afternoon. Steady energy, clear thinking, and a stable appetite often signal that your intake of carbohydrate, protein, and fat matches your daily routine.
